We took a look at the Dell Chromebook 3100 back in July. We gave it 4 stars and a Recommended badge. The review said, "With a solid keyboard, great battery life with an even greater charger, and the Dell durability we knew and trust, there's a reason this Chromebook took runner-up in our Best Chromebooks for Students roundup."
The 3100 has an Intel N3350 dual-core 1.1 GHz processor, 16GB flash storage, and 4GB DDR4 memory. It uses Chrome OS and relies on the Google Cloud for a lot of the work you do. It also has an HD touchscreen.
The Dell 5190 that costs $10 more in this sale is very similar. It's also a 2-in-1 convertible laptop so you can flip it over to a tablet. The battery life lasts up to 10 hours, and it comes with two USB-C ports. You can charge from either port and use the free one for accessories or peripherals.
These are both "educational" Chromebooks in that they are designed to be used by students. That means a sealed, spill-resistant keyboard, which can handle 12-ounce spills. The notebooks also have protective bumpers and can withstand 30-inch drops. Get your kids a laptop that can survive the dangers of school life.
